Question 1 of 5

If a suppository becomes soft, which action should the nurse take?

Correct Answer: A

Rationale: The correct answer is A: Hold the foil-wrapped suppository under cold water for a short time. This action is correct because cooling the suppository will help it regain its original consistency, making it easier to insert without melting. Option B is incorrect as administering a soft suppository may lead to leakage or incomplete absorption. Option C is incorrect as inserting a soft suppository can be uncomfortable for the patient and may not deliver the medication effectively. Option D is incorrect as returning it to the pharmacy for replacement is not necessary if it can be salvaged by cooling.
